In the administration of any matter, the procedure for which is not specified by any applicable provision of law or of any rule or regulation, a specific procedure may be authorized by the commissioner by analogy to any statute or rule of court calculated to achieve a fair, efficient and proper presentation, management and disposition of the matter involved.
N.J. Stat. Ann. § 17B:34-11
Matters not otherwise provided for
